A prominent organization monitoring global hunger issues warns that “the worst case scenario of famine” is developing in Gaza as Israel temporarily halts military actions in certain areas. Despite these claims,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u stated earlier this week that “there is no policy of starvation in Gaza,” contrasting with former President Donald Trump’s opinion. “That’s real starvation stuff. I see it, and you can’t fake that,” Trump commented. NBC’s Matt Bradley provides a report for TODAY.
